What are some common challenges faced by remote hotel workers based in the Dominican Republic, and how can they be overcome?

Remote hotel workers in the Dominican Republic often face challenges such as maintaining clear communication with on-site staff, managing time zone differences with international guests, and ensuring reliable internet connectivity. Overcoming these hurdles usually involves using robust collaboration tools, setting up regular virtual meetings, and having backup plans for connectivity issues. Building strong relationships with team members and staying proactive in communication can help remote workers stay aligned with hotel operations and provide excellent guest service from a distance.

What is a remote average Dominican hotel worker?

Remote average Dominican hotel workers are hospitality professionals based in the Dominican Republic who perform their duties for hotels or hospitality businesses from a remote location, often using digital tools and communication platforms. Their roles may include reservations, customer service, administrative support, or online guest relations. This setup enables hotels to provide services and support to guests without requiring all staff to be on-site, increasing flexibility and access to a broader talent pool. These workers typically have good communication skills, familiarity with hospitality software, and the ability to work independently. Working remotely can offer better work-life balance and access to international employment opportunities.
